Our law firm was founded and is sustained on certain fundamental principles --- that greed is not the greatest good, that domination of the many by the few is not inherent in human nature, that it is possible to improve our society by serving a social movement dedicated to improving the lives of the majority who do most of the work.

Each of us has therefore chosen to join a law firm which offers its skills and expertise to the labor movement. We do this because we believe there is more to our work than just earning a living; we believe that a strong and vibrant labor movement is essential to a just, fair, and democratic society. We believe that the best way we can make our contribution to a better world is by doing meaningful work to help build, support, defend, and sustain the labor movement and its allies.

To achieve these ends, we have built the largest law firm in the country representing Unions, their members, and their related benefit funds.
